Section 1: Understanding the Fundamentals of Economic Analysis

A Professional Certificate in Measuring Project Value with Economic Analysis provides a comprehensive understanding of economic analysis techniques, including cost-benefit analysis, break-even analysis, and sensitivity analysis. These techniques enable professionals to evaluate project viability, identify potential risks, and optimize resource allocation. For instance, a recent case study of a construction project in Dubai demonstrated the effectiveness of cost-benefit analysis in determining the feasibility of a new development project. By applying this technique, the project team was able to identify the most cost-effective solutions, resulting in significant cost savings and improved project outcomes.

Section 2: Practical Applications in Project Management

One of the primary benefits of a Professional Certificate in Measuring Project Value with Economic Analysis is its practical application in project management. By applying economic analysis techniques, professionals can make informed decisions about project scope, schedule, and budget. For example, a case study of a software development project in Silicon Valley highlighted the use of break-even analysis to determine the optimal pricing strategy for a new product launch. By analyzing the project's costs and revenue projections, the team was able to set a competitive price point that ensured a quick return on investment.
